Do eukaryotic microorganisms have ribosomes?

Naturally, all eukaryotic organisms, unicellular and multicellular, contain ribosomes. Even eukaryotic microorganisms require ribosomes for life because ribosomes are essential in the process of gene expression.


What is and example of Ribosomes?

Ribosomes are cellular organelles responsible for protein synthesis. An example of ribosomes in action is during translation, where they read the mRNA genetic code and assemble amino acids into a functional protein. This process occurs in all cells, from bacteria to humans, highlighting the universal nature of ribosomes.

What are some real life analogys of ribosomes?

Ribosomes can be thought of as assembly lines in a factory, where they read instructions (mRNA) to build proteins in a specific order. Another analogy is thinking of ribosomes as chefs in a kitchen following a recipe (mRNA) to make a dish (protein).

The sites of protein synthesis are?

Protein synthesis occurs at ribosomes, which can be found in the cytoplasm of a cell. In eukaryotic cells, proteins can also be synthesized on ribosomes located on the rough endoplasmic reticulum.
